Вступ
JSON є скрізь у роботі API, але необроблені корисні навантаження важко обґрунтувати, коли вони надходять мінімізованими, глибоко вкладеними або частково зламаними. Форматувальник допомагає, оскільки перетворює структуру на те, що люди можуть сканувати, налагоджувати та пояснювати.
Для пошуку, орієнтованого на початківців, це має велике значення. Багато читачів, які використовують цей запит, не запитують розширену теорію парсера. Їм потрібен практичний спосіб отримати нерозбірливу відповідь API та зрозуміти її досить швидко, щоб продовжувати рухатися.
Тому цей посібник повинен робити більше, ніж пояснювати відступи. У ньому має бути пояснено, яке форматування змінюється, коли перевірка має значення, чому локальна обробка може бути корисною та як перейти від необробленого корисного навантаження до артефакту налагодження, яким можна ділитися.
Яке форматування насправді змінюється
Форматування не змінює значення JSON. Це змінює презентацію. Розриви рядків, відступи та інтервали знову роблять об’єкти та масиви доступними для читання без зміни самого корисного навантаження.
Це важливо, оскільки новачки часто хвилюються, що можуть порушити дані, прикрашаючи їх. Більш безпечне пояснення полягає в тому, що форматування допомагає людям перевіряти структуру. Це крок читабельності, а не крок перетворення даних.
Чому перевірка належить до того самого робочого процесу
Читабельний JSON є корисним, але дійсний JSON є справжньою першою контрольною точкою. Якщо корисне навантаження має неправильний формат, жодне форматування не виправить це автоматично. Інструмент має показати, де синтаксис порушується, щоб користувач міг це виправити.
Ось чому форматування та перевірка належать до однієї поверхні інструменту. Користувачеві не потрібно переходити між окремими утилітами, щоб з’ясувати, чи JSON зламаний чи просто нечитабельний.
- Форматуйте, якщо корисне навантаження дійсне, але безладне.
- Перевірте, якщо корисне навантаження може бути неправильним.
- Використовуйте обидва під час швидкого налагодження відповідей API.
Простий робочий процес для початківців для корисних навантажень API
Почніть із вставлення необробленої відповіді в форматер. Якщо перевірка не вдається, спочатку виправте синтаксичну проблему. Якщо перевірка пройшла, відскануйте ключі верхнього рівня, а потім перейдіть до вкладених масивів і об’єктів із чіткішою ментальною картою структури.
Якщо JSON стане читабельним, стане набагато легше скопіювати корисні фрагменти в документацію, квитки або груповий чат. Це також є частиною справжнього робочого процесу, особливо коли налагодження є спільним.
- Вставте або завантажте корисне навантаження JSON.
- Спочатку запустіть форматування або перевірте.
- Перевірте ключові шляхи та вкладені значення.
- Скопіюйте очищений результат для документів, заявок або перегляду коду.
Чому форматування JSON у браузері може matter
Корисне навантаження API часто включає внутрішні дані, тестові фікстури, тимчасові токени або специфічні відповіді середовища, які не слід випадково вставляти в службу третьої сторони. Форматування на основі браузера зменшує цей ризик, зберігаючи робочий процес локальним.
Це особливо актуально для команд, які налагоджують проміжні або внутрішні системи. Навіть якщо корисне навантаження формально не є конфіденційним, часто безпечніше та швидше залишити крок форматування на пристрої.
Що повинен робити користувач після прочитання цього посібника
Якщо наступним завданням є чиста читабельність і перевірка, відкрийте JSON Formatter. Якщо це завдання порівняння, перейдіть до засобу перевірки відмінностей або вбудованого процесу порівняння. Якщо завданням є перетворення між форматами даних, перейдіть до CSV JSON Converter. Посібник найкраще працює, коли ця наступна дія є явною.
Ця структура також покращує якість SEO, оскільки вона пов’язує навчальний запит із ширшим кластером робочого процесу замість того, щоб розглядати статтю як ізольований вміст.